In an exclusive interview with GMB, Henrique De Simoni, LatAm account manager at 3 Oaks Gaming, discusses the company's strategy for the growing Brazilian betting market. With the recent regulation of the sector, he explains how they position themselves to take advantage of opportunities in the country and strengthen their presence in Latin America. The executive also discusses the importance of adapting products to local preferences and reveals initiatives for social responsibility in gaming.

Games Magazine Brasil - How is 3 Oaks Gaming positioning itself in the Brazilian betting market? What are the main goals of the company for Brazil in the coming years?  
Henrique De Simoni -
At 3 Oaks Gaming, we recognize the immense potential that Brazil and Latin America offer, positioning these regions as strategic pillars for our global growth. We have already established a solid presence in Latin America, with a portfolio of popular titles such as Coin Volcano and 3 Hot Chillies, which have been very well received by local players.

 



Our goal is to continuously enhance the gaming experience, ensuring that we offer innovative and engaging products that captivate the end user. We aim to be market leaders, aligning our professionalism and creativity with the constantly evolving needs of this competitive landscape.

Brazil, in particular, is central to our long-term strategy, and we are committed to becoming one of the main players in the market.

With the recent regulation of the betting sector in Brazil, how do you assess the impact of these new laws on the operations and expansion of 3 Oaks Gaming in the country?  
The regulation of the betting and gaming market in Brazil is a significant and very welcome development for us. It brings the much-needed structure and security to the industry, benefiting all stakeholders, including operators, players, and service providers like us. The regulation fosters trust and ensures that the sector operates responsibly, which is fully aligned with our approach.

As we already operate in regulated markets, such as Romania, Greece, and Italy, we are well-prepared to meet the regulatory standards of Brazil. This new scenario creates a stable environment for us to grow and collaborate with local partners, and we see this as a positive step for both our clients and the market in general.

What are the main opportunities you see for 3 Oaks Gaming in the Brazilian market, considering the current regulatory scenario?   
The regulatory change opens exciting opportunities for us, especially in terms of forming new partnerships and consolidating our position in the market. Many of our clients are already taking steps to comply with the new regulations, which creates a favorable environment for collaboration.

With our extensive experience in regulated markets, we are well positioned to support operators in this transition.

We also expect to see significant merger and acquisition activity in Brazil, which will further boost growth. Overall, this new regulatory framework creates ideal conditions for us to expand our market share and strengthen relationships with key industry players.

How is 3 Oaks Gaming adapting its products and services to meet the needs and preferences of Brazilian players?  
We have a strong focus on adapting our content to local preferences. With our experience as both an operator and a supplier, we continuously study player behavior and work closely with operators to adjust our offerings.

Brazilian players seek an engaging and immersive entertainment experience, and our games deliver just that. The vibrant themes, music, and interactive features of our titles create an exciting and challenging gaming experience — characteristics that we know resonate well with the Brazilian audience.

Can you share details about new products or launches that 3 Oaks Gaming is planning specifically for the Brazilian market?  
While our global development team is constantly working on new concepts, we already have a good understanding of what appeals to Brazilian players. Our most recent release, Amazonia Spirit, was designed with the local market in mind, featuring the Amazon rainforest theme and native animals such as toucans, marmosets, and jaguars.

 



This game reflects our commitment to producing culturally relevant content that attracts Brazilian players. We will continue to explore themes and mechanics that align with local tastes as we expand our portfolio.

What have been the biggest challenges that 3 Oaks Gaming faced when entering the Brazilian market, and how has the company overcome these challenges?  
Undoubtedly, the biggest challenge was strong competition. The Brazilian market is highly attractive, with many companies vying for the public's attention. However, we have managed to stand out by focusing on delivering exceptional products and offering a high-quality user experience.

Our approach to game design, which combines cutting-edge technology with fun and engaging mechanics, helps us differentiate ourselves. We are confident that our unique offerings and our dedication to customer satisfaction give us a competitive edge.

How is 3 Oaks Gaming collaborating with operators and local partners in Brazil? Are there plans for new partnerships or collaborations in the near future?  
The demand for our games among Brazilian operators is strong, and our partnerships are growing. We work closely with key players, such as F12, Estrela, galera.bet, and Betsat, and we have other operators who will soon integrate our games.

The feedback we receive from our partners has been extremely positive, with many of our titles consistently ranking among the top two or three most played on their platforms. We are actively seeking new collaborations, and our goal is to further deepen our presence in Brazil in the coming months.

What is your view on the evolution of gaming regulation in Brazil? Are there specific aspects that you believe should be improved or adjusted?  
The regulatory journey in Brazil is just beginning, and the next year will be a decisive period for the online market in the country. As with any new regulation, there will be challenges in the initial phases, especially in the first six months, as all parties adapt.

However, the foundations are solid, as Brazil is drawing inspiration from regulatory models of well-established markets, such as the United Kingdom. Over time, we will likely see some adjustments, but for now, it is important to be agile and ensure that we comply with all current and future regulations. Companies that anticipate these changes will certainly reap the greatest benefits.

How is 3 Oaks Gaming addressing the issue of compliance and social responsibility in the Brazilian market, especially regarding responsible gaming practices?  
Compliance and responsible gaming are top priorities for 3 Oaks Gaming. We already meet strict compliance standards across all our licenses in jurisdictions such as the Isle of Man and Malta.

For Brazil, we are closely monitoring evolving regulations to ensure that we remain fully compliant.

We advocate for responsible entertainment and have safety measures in place, such as age verification on our platforms. As the local regulatory framework matures, we will continue to prioritize responsible gaming and adjust our practices as necessary.

What will be the biggest competitive advantage of 3 Oaks Gaming in Brazil compared to other companies in the sector?  
Our clients always tell us that the level of service we provide is what sets us apart. From our integration teams to our account managers, we strive to provide personalized support. This dedication to building solid relationships is often mentioned as one of our main differentiators.

Additionally, our games are designed with the Brazilian market in mind, offering vibrant visuals, engaging mechanics, and a seamless user experience that players find easy to enjoy. This combination of strong service and attractive products is what makes us stand out.

How is the market growing in Brazil compared to other countries in Latin America?   Brazil is on track to become one of our main global markets, and certainly the most significant in Latin America.

The size and potential of the market are unmatched. While Mexico and Argentina are also important markets for us, the scale, demographics, and growth opportunities in Brazil put it in a league of its own.

As we expand our presence in the region, Brazil will continue to play a key role in our strategy, and I believe it will become one of our top three global markets in the near future.
